The Problem

Your AI Is Moving Faster Than Your Security

GenAI is being deployed across your products, pipelines, and business processes — often faster than security teams can keep up. AI systems carry a new class of risks that traditional tools were never built to catch.

💉
Prompt Injection & Jailbreaks

Attackers craft inputs that bypass your AI's guardrails, forcing it to reveal confidential data, execute unintended actions, or generate harmful content.

🔓
Model Data Leakage

LLMs trained or fine-tuned on your data can surface sensitive information — PII, trade secrets, internal documents — in response to adversarial prompts.

🤖
Excessive AI Agency

Agentic AI systems with broad permissions can be weaponised — allowing attackers to reach databases, APIs, and downstream services through a compromised model.

🛡️
Guardrail Bypass

Cloud-native guardrails tell you what's configured, not whether it works. Attackers routinely bypass them with simple prompt reformulations.

📋
Compliance Blind Spots

Boards and regulators are asking about AI risk. Without OWASP LLM, NIST AI RMF, or EU AI Act coverage, you have no defensible audit trail.

👁️
No Visibility Across AI Deployments

Enterprises running multiple AI agents across accounts, regions, and cloud providers have no single pane of glass for AI security posture.
